What is Little Nightmares 2 All About?
First things first, let's start with a refresher of Little Nightmares 2.
Little Nightmares 2 puts players in the shoes of a young boy named Mono, who journeys through the Pale City to find out the reason behind the world-disrupting humming transmission. However, Mono will not be alone.
The female protagonist from Little Nightmares, Six, will return as a companion as the two of them go from one creepy place to another.
